Stamps signal Nationwide LB Dan Basambombo

CALGARY — The Calgary Stampeders have signed nationwide linebacker Dan Basambombo and added him to the workforce’s observe roster, the workforce introduced on Monday.

The Université Laval alum was a second-round choice by the Ottawa Redblacks within the 2020 Canadian Soccer League draft and performed 23 video games with Ottawa in 2021 and 2022, recording six special-teams tackles.

At Laval, Basambombo performed 14 video games over three seasons. Over the course of his profession with the Rouge et Or, he collected 42 tackles together with 4 tackles for loss, three sacks, two pressured fumbles and two fumble recoveries.

Basambomo was a Réseau du sport étudiant du Québec (RSEQ) all-star for Laval in 2018 after recording 31.5 tackles together with three tackles for loss, two sacks, one pressured fumble and one fumble restoration in eight video games.

Basambombo was born in Congo and moved to Canada along with his household on the age of 9. He attended École Secondaire Catholique Franco-Cité in Ottawa and performed junior soccer with the Cumberland Panthers.
